Hello

I want to start a clan. But I have very many issues with servers. First, Is there a way I can run multiple servers at once from one computer? And then in the past when I have run servers I couldnt run a server and play Halo at the same time. And then is there a way I can run a server with out having it open on my computer at all times (Having all of my clans servers minimized on my bar at the bottom)

Thanks

You can run the server with the argument -port X where X is the port number you want the server to run on. No servers can use the same port as another. Not sure how to solve the playing on the server machine, though.

The secret to playing on a server machine is to once again think with ports. ;)


simply change your client port to a different one than the server's and you should be good.

For example, if you're running servers off ports 2303,2304, and 2305 then it would be a safe bet to try and set your halo client's settings to say.... 2309. I usually choose a few numbers higher just to play it safe in case it doesn't work or if you wanna add more servers later.
